Job Requirements
- High school diploma or equivalent
- currently enrolled in an accredited surgical technology program
- successfully completed all clinical training as defined by the accredited surgical technology program or completion of in-classroom training of the first semester of an accredited surgical tech program
- basic life support (BLS) certification
- actively maintaining enrollment in the surgical technology school program
- ability to work efficiently in a dynamic operating room environment
- ability to follow aseptic techniques and safety guidelines

Job Duties
- Provide intraoperative care to patients during operative procedures
- assist the surgical team during operative procedures
- aid other members of the OR team in assessing, planning, implementing and evaluating patient care duties including transport of patients
- assist in patient positioning, supply readiness and location
- provide terminal cleaning and between case preparation
- facilitate a smooth and efficient transition between surgical procedures
- maintain a clean, safe environment and adhere to aseptic principles and technique
- participate in performance improvement initiatives
